Understanding Espresso Machines
Espresso machines are designed to brew coffee by requiring warm water through finely-ground coffee beans. They come in different types, including manual, semi-automatic, automatic, and super-automatic. Each of these categories provides various levels of control and benefit.
Types of Espresso Machines
Type | Description | Pros | Cons |
---|---|---|---|
Manual | Needs total manual control over the brewing process. | Full control over extraction | Steeper learning curve |
Semi-Automatic | Integrates manual and automatic features, permitting varied control. | Versatile, easy to use | Requires ability for best outcomes |
Automatic | Immediately controls the developing time; less hands-on than semi-automatic. | Practical for novices | Limited modification |
Super-Automatic | Totally automated, with built-in mills and milk frothers. | Extremely convenient | Higher cost point |
Understanding these differences can substantially influence your buying decisions during a clearance sale. It's vital to know what you're looking for based upon your coffee preferences and how hands-on you desire to be throughout brewing.

Essential Features to Look for in an Espresso Machine
When selecting an espresso machine, especially from a clearance sale, it's essential to evaluate essential features. Here are numerous important functions that can considerably affect your home brewing experience:
- Boiler Type: Choose in between single, double, or heat exchanger boilers based on how frequently you brew and if you need simultaneous brewing and steaming.
- Size and Capacity: Consider counter space and the number of cups you require to brew at once.
- Grinder Quality: If purchasing a machine without an integrated grinder, ensure you have a high-quality burr grinder to accomplish the ideal grind size.
- Pressure Control: Machines that preserve stable pressure throughout the brewing process normally yield much better espresso.
- Ease of Clean-Up: Look for machines with detachable components and easy-to-clean surfaces.
